Improving TCP Performance in Mobile Computing Environments

In this paper we examine several aspects of performance and connection management during handoffs and interface switching in mobile computing environments. We demonstrate the insufficiency of network layer mobility protocols to preserve highperformance operation of reliable transport protocols such as TCP under certain circumstances. We also introduce a mobility-aware transport, Mobile TCP, that maintains robust operation despite lossy mobile activity. Experimental results are presented and discussed.

متن کاملATCP: Improving TCP performance over mobile wireless environments
Transmission Control Protocol (TCP) is known to suffer from performance degradation in mobile wireless environments. This is because such environments are prone to packet losses due to high bit error rates and mobility induced disconnections.
